Output 50e4dc54c6a74332a7950a0dd9ba5a7a1891d1f5a761ae3579c140bb6647abd0:39

value
428928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4292d2a0db674539637b2f79424081fe8e6a4e07 OP_EQUAL
address
37m2QdT4mNkzACDKszvuQrpqC76as6ff4P
transaction
50e4dc54c6a74332a7950a0dd9ba5a7a1891d1f5a761ae3579c140bb6647abd0
spent
true